This Gluten free pancake mix is from SunCakeMom.
Mix all the ingredients except the oil for frying together until the batter has a smooth consistency.
Heat frying pan on medium heat then brush it lightly with oil before we scoop the batter into it.
Scoop or pour half ladle of batter in it.
Fry one side of the pancake then after about 30-40 seconds flip it over and get the other side until light brown.
Repeat it until all of the healthy pancake batter is used up.
Serve them nice and warm with homemade sugar free jams or grated apples.
